Quickemu突破边界:打造无缝衔接的便携式虚拟工作空间创新应用
【免费下载链接】quickemuQuickly create and run optimised Windows, macOS and Linux desktop virtual machines.项目地址: https://gitcode.com/GitHub_Trending/qu/quickemu
为什么传统移动办公方案总是差强人意?
当你带着笔记本电脑奔波于机场、酒店和客户办公室时,是否曾渴望过一种更轻盈的工作方式?传统移动办公方案要么受限于云存储的网络依赖,要么受制于笔记本电脑的硬件性能,而Quickemu就像一把数字瑞士军刀,将完整的操作系统环境压缩进你的口袋,让任何电脑都能瞬间变身为你的专属工作站。
重新定义移动计算:Quickemu的核心价值
想象一下,你的工作环境不再绑定于特定硬件,而是像U盘里的文档一样随取随用。Quickemu通过简化QEMU虚拟机技术,创造了一种全新的计算范式——它不是在本地安装软件,而是将整个操作系统环境封装成可移动的数字资产。这种"操作系统即插即用"的理念,彻底打破了传统计算设备的物理边界。
核心技术原理解析
Quickemu本质上是QEMU的智能配置前端,就像给复杂的机械手表装上了直观的电子表盘。它通过预设的优化配置文件,自动处理虚拟机创建过程中的硬件适配、性能调优和资源分配,让普通用户也能轻松驾驭专业级虚拟化技术。
场景化解决方案:让技术融入工作流
构建跨设备工作流
自由职业者的数字 briefcase
设计师小林需要在客户办公室展示方案,但对方的电脑没有安装专业设计软件。通过Quickemu,她将完整的设计环境(包括软件、插件和素材库)存储在高速移动硬盘中,只需插入任何电脑即可立即开始工作,避免了软件安装和环境配置的麻烦。
开发者的一致测试环境
程序员张伟经常在公司台式机和家用笔记本之间切换工作。使用Quickemu后,他在USB设备中维护了一个标准化开发环境,包含所有依赖库和配置文件,确保代码在不同设备上表现一致,消除了"在我电脑上能运行"的尴尬。
教育机构的教学工具包
计算机老师李教授为学生准备了包含各种操作系统和开发环境的移动教学包。学生只需将USB插入实验室电脑,即可使用预设的课程环境,大大减少了课堂准备时间和技术支持需求。
突破边界:Quickemu与传统方案的对比优势
| 评估维度 | Quickemu方案 | 传统笔记本方案 | 云桌面方案 |
|---|---|---|---|
| 硬件依赖性 | 无,适配任何电脑 | 高度依赖特定设备 | 依赖网络和服务器 |
| 启动时间 | 30-60秒 | 60-120秒 | 取决于网络状况 |
| 数据安全性 | 本地存储,物理可控 | 设备丢失风险高 | 依赖服务商安全措施 |
| 性能表现 | 接近原生性能 | 受限于硬件配置 | 受网络延迟影响 |
| 便携性 | 仅需口袋大小的USB设备 | 需要携带笔记本电脑 | 仅需终端设备 |
| 维护成本 | 单一环境维护 | 多设备同步更新 | 依赖服务商维护 |
实施步骤:打造你的便携式虚拟工作空间
准备阶段:选择合适的硬件装备
你需要准备:
- USB 3.2 Gen 2或更高规格的存储设备(建议容量≥64GB,NVMe移动硬盘可获得最佳性能)
- 具备USB 3.0+接口的主机电脑(Linux、macOS或Windows系统)
- 稳定的网络连接(用于下载操作系统镜像)
部署阶段:从安装到启动的完整流程
获取Quickemu工具集
git clone https://gitcode.com/GitHub_Trending/qu/quickemu #克隆项目仓库 cd quickemu #进入项目目录安装依赖组件
# Ubuntu/Debian系统示例 sudo apt install -y bash coreutils curl grep jq ovmf qemu-system-x86 \ swtpm-tools unzip usbutils xdg-user-dirs zsync #安装核心依赖包注意事项:不同Linux发行版的依赖包名称可能略有差异,详细列表可参考项目中的安装文档。
创建定制虚拟机
./quickget fedora 38 #下载Fedora 38并生成配置迁移至USB设备
mkdir -p /media/$(whoami)/MYUSB/quickemu-vms #创建目标目录 mv fedora-38* /media/$(whoami)/MYUSB/quickemu-vms/ #移动虚拟机文件优化配置参数
nano /media/$(whoami)/MYUSB/quickemu-vms/fedora-38.conf #编辑配置文件在配置文件中调整以下关键参数:
memory="8192" #分配8GB内存(根据主机配置调整) cores="4" #分配4个CPU核心 disk_size="64G" #设置磁盘大小为64GB usb_devices="on" #启用USB设备直通启动移动虚拟机
cd /media/$(whoami)/MYUSB/quickemu-vms #进入USB设备目录 ../../quickemu --vm fedora-38.conf #启动虚拟机
验证阶段:性能优化指标评估
创建虚拟机后,建议通过以下指标评估性能:
- 启动时间:从命令执行到桌面环境可用应控制在90秒内
- 应用响应:常用办公软件启动时间应接近原生系统
- 文件传输:内部文件复制速度应达到USB设备理论速度的70%以上
- 多任务处理:同时运行3个以上应用程序不应出现明显卡顿
拓展应用:解锁行业特定场景
软件开发与测试
开发人员可以为不同项目创建独立的虚拟机环境,避免开发依赖冲突。通过配置快照功能,可以快速在不同开发阶段之间切换,极大提高测试效率。
信息安全与取证
安全专家可使用Quickemu创建隔离的分析环境,在不影响主机系统的情况下检查可疑文件和程序。USB便携性使得现场取证工作更加灵活安全。
教育培训
培训机构可以为不同课程准备标准化的教学环境,学生使用自己的USB设备即可获取一致的学习体验,降低设备差异带来的教学障碍。
企业IT支持
IT管理员可创建包含诊断工具和修复程序的移动救援环境,快速响应不同地点的技术支持需求,减少现场维护时间。
持续优化:打造个性化移动工作空间
随着使用深入,你可以通过以下方式进一步优化Quickemu体验:
- 创建多系统环境:在同一USB设备中维护多个操作系统,根据需求选择启动
- 配置自动备份:设置定时快照功能,保护重要工作数据
- 优化启动脚本:创建自定义启动脚本,自动调整虚拟机参数以适应不同主机硬件
- 集成云存储:在虚拟机中配置云同步工具,实现本地环境与云端数据的无缝衔接
Quickemu不仅是一款工具,更是一种新的计算理念的体现——它让我们重新思考硬件与软件的关系,打破了传统计算设备的束缚。在这个信息流动日益加速的时代,能够随身携带完整工作环境的能力,将成为提升生产力的关键因素。无论你是数字游民、开发人员还是企业用户,Quickemu都能为你打开一扇通往更自由、更灵活工作方式的大门。
现在就开始打造你的专属移动虚拟工作空间,体验技术带来的真正自由吧!
【免费下载链接】quickemuQuickly create and run optimised Windows, macOS and Linux desktop virtual machines.项目地址: https://gitcode.com/GitHub_Trending/qu/quickemu
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考